# Servelm - Elm Http Server
# Deprecated. Server side elm is not designed to work this way.
This server, along with rtfeldman's Elm stylesheets, means that we can now have full stack Elm support. At no point in the development of an application will you have to write anything other than Elm!
It now supports server-side rendering of elm-html.
A demo can be found [here](http://107.170.81.176/). The styling is done through compile-time correct CSS provided by [elm-stylesheets](https://github.com/rtfeldman/elm-stylesheets).
# APIs exposed
The Http.Server module allows you to create servers and run them.
## Sending out Elm
Use the `Http.Response.writeElm` function to compile an Elm file on request. It will compile an Elm file found with `name + ".elm""`. It will write the output to a file in the same folder as `name + ".html"`. This will then be served out to the client. There is basic caching involved at the moment, which works based on the lifecycle of the server. Restart the server if you make any changes.
This is enabled by the [node-elm-compiler](https://github.com/rtfeldman/node-elm-compiler) package.
It also supports server-side rendering of elm-html, through using the [vdom-to-html](https://github.com/nthtran/vdom-to-html) package.
## Get started
To start Elm inside of Node simply this to the end of your compiled Elm code.
```JavaScript
Elm.worker(Elm.Main);
```
Take a look at `example/run.sh` to see a complete usage
```bash
elm make example/server/Main.elm --output=example/main.js
echo "Elm.worker(Elm.Main);" >> example/main.js
node example/main.js
```
## Run the example
This project depends on Node.js and the `node` command.
```bash
example/run.sh
```
Then load up the browser to see it working!
# Credit
Originally inspired by https://github.com/Fresheyeball/elm-http-server.
There was some great work already there, I just cleaned it up a little and integrated it with some other packages.

module Http.Response.Write
( write, writeHead
, writeHtml, writeJson
, writeFile, writeElm
, writeNode
, end) where
import Native.Http.Response.Write
import Task exposing (Task, andThen)
import VirtualDom exposing (Node)
import Json.Encode as Json
import Http.Response exposing (textHtml, applicationJson, Header, Response, StatusCode)
{-| Write Headers to a Response
[Node Docs](https://nodejs.org/api/http.html#http_response_writehead_statuscode_statusmessage_headers) -}
writeHead : StatusCode -> Header -> Response -> Task x Response
writeHead = Native.Http.Response.Write.writeHead
{-| Write body to a Response
[Node Docs](https://nodejs.org/api/http.html#http_response_write_chunk_encoding_callback) -}
write : String -> Response -> Task x Response
write = Native.Http.Response.Write.write
{-| End a Response
[Node Docs](https://nodejs.org/api/http.html#http_response_end_data_encoding_callback) -}
end : Response -> Task x ()
end = Native.Http.Response.Write.end
writeAs : Header -> String -> Response -> Task x ()
writeAs header html res =
writeHead 200 header res
`andThen` write html `andThen` end
{-| Write out HTML to a Response. For example
res `writeHtml` "<h1>Howdy</h1>"
-}
writeHtml : String -> Response -> Task x ()
writeHtml = writeAs textHtml
{-| Write out JSON to a Response. For example
res `writeJson` Json.object
[ ("foo", Json.string "bar")
, ("baz", Json.int 0) ]
-}
writeJson : Json.Value -> Response -> Task x ()
writeJson val res =
writeAs applicationJson (Json.encode 0 val) res
{-| write a file -}
writeFile : String -> Response -> Task a ()
writeFile file res =
writeHead 200 textHtml res
`andThen` Native.Http.Response.Write.writeFile file
`andThen` end
{-| write elm! -}
writeElm : String -> Response -> Task a ()
writeElm file res =
writeHead 200 textHtml res
`andThen` Native.Http.Response.Write.writeElm file
`andThen` end
writeNode : Node -> Response -> Task a ()
writeNode node res =
writeHead 200 textHtml res
`andThen` Native.Http.Response.Write.writeNode node
`andThen` end

module Http.Server
( createServer, createServer', listen
, Port, Server
, onRequest, onClose) where
{-| Simple bindings to Node.js's Http.Server
# Init the server
## Instaniation
@docs createServer, createServer'
## Actually listen
@docs listen
## Types
@docs Server, Port
# Listen for events
@docs onRequest, onClose
-}
import Task exposing (Task, succeed, andThen)
import Signal exposing (Address, Mailbox, mailbox)
import Json.Encode as Json
import Http.Request exposing (Request)
import Http.Response exposing (Response)
import Http.Listeners exposing (on)
import Native.Http
{-| Port number for the server to listen -}
type alias Port = Int
{-| Node.js native Server object
[Node Docs](https://nodejs.org/api/http.html#http_class_http_server) -}
type Server = Server
{-| "Request" events as a Signal.
[Node docs](https://nodejs.org/api/http.html#http_event_request) -}
onRequest : Server -> Signal (Request, Response)
onRequest = on "request"
{-| "Close" events as a Signal for Servers.
[Node docs](https://nodejs.org/api/http.html#http_event_close) -}
onClose : Server -> Signal ()
onClose = on "close"
{-| Create a new Http Server, and send (Request, Response) to an Address. For example
port serve : Task x Server
port serve = createServer server.address
[Node docs](https://nodejs.org/api/http.html#http_http_createserver_requestlistener)
-}
createServer : Address (Request, Response) -> Task x Server
createServer = Native.Http.createServer
{-| Create a Http Server and listen in one command! For example
port serve : Task x Server
port serve = createServer' server.address 8080 "Alive on 8080!"
-}
createServer' : Address (Request, Response) -> Port -> String -> Task x Server
createServer' address port' text =
createServer address `andThen` listen port' text
{-| Command Server to listen on a specific port,
and echo a message to the console when active.
Task will not resolve until listening is successful.
For example
port listen : Task x Server
port listen = listen 8080 "Listening on 8080" server
[Node Docs](https://nodejs.org/api/http.html#http_server_listen_port_hostname_backlog_callback)
-}
listen : Port -> String -> Server -> Task x Server
listen = Native.Http.listen
